1. |
Suspension angle change resulted from vehicle's load change.
|
2. |
Sensor angle change.
|
3. |
Microprocessor calculates necessary head lamp angle change amount.
|
4. |
Sending a proper signal to head lamp leveling device and driving
actuator.
|
1. |
Ignition on
|
2. |
Low beam on
|
3. |
On stop : If sensor lever change is 0.7° and above, head lamp
is operated after max. 1.5 sec.
|
4. |
On driving : If vehicle velocity is over 4km/h(2.48mile/h), velocity
change is not over 0.8-1.6km/h(0.5 ~ 1.0mile/h) per second, and loading
condition is changed, then head lamp is operated.
